Oklahoma Library for the Blind and Physically Handicapped provides free library services to blind, visually impaired and mentally disabled students. Based in Oklahoma City, Okla., the organization offers reading materials in special audio format on cassette or digital book cartridge as well as in Braille. Its ATM center also provides various educational items for kindergarten through grade 12 students. The Visual Services Division of the Oklahoma Department of Rehabilitation Services operates the Oklahoma Library for the Blind and Physically Handicapped.
